    Who is Dr. Shabsigh, Specialist in New York, NY?

    Dr. Ridwan Shabsigh, MD is a Specialist, who primarily practices in New York, NY. He has been practicing for over 43 years and is board certified by the American Board of Urology. Dr. Shabsigh completed his residency at Baylor Coll Of Med, Urology. Dr. Shabsigh is fluent in English and Spanish,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Shabsigh’s practice accepts Medicare, UnitedHealthcare, Aetna and other major insurance plans.     Is this Dr. Ridwan Shabsigh aff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Shabsigh is affiliated with NewYork-Presbyterian Hospital/Weill Cornell Medical Center which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
